On all platforms, Adaptive Server IQ uses memory for four primary purposes:
Main buffer cache
Temporary buffer cache
Thread stacks
Load buffers
See Figure 12-1: Buffer caches in relation to physical memory earlier in this
chapter for a diagram of IQ memory use.
The HP UNIX and AIX platforms limit the total amount of memory available
to IQ or any other single application. You must set IQ server options on these
platforms in order to gain the maximum usable memory.
